The image presents a roadside scene at sunset or late afternoon, marked by low-angle golden light. In the immediate foreground, a yellow rectangular sign with black text clearly states "ESCH-SUR-ALZETTE" and "Esch-Uelzecht," identifying the location as the city of Esch-sur-Alzette, Luxembourg. This sign is mounted on a dark metal frame. Directly above and slightly to the right, a smaller rectangular yellow sign displays the number "170." Centrally positioned above these, a circular regulatory speed limit sign features a red border, white background, and the number "50" in black. To the left of these signs, a two-lane asphalt road stretches into the distance, its surface reflecting the warm, setting sunlight. A blue sedan is visible in the left lane, traveling away from the viewer, its rear illuminated by the sun's glare. Further down the road, a white commercial van is also observed moving in the same direction. The area to the right of the road and signs consists of a grassy verge and numerous bare-branched deciduous trees, silhouetted against the bright sky. The setting sun, a prominent golden light source, is positioned in the upper left background, casting a strong glare and creating silhouettes of distant trees and indistinct architectural forms. The sky graduates from bright yellow-orange near the horizon to a pale blue-grey overhead. No discernible people are present.
